I'm worried it's a tumor. I took my rabbit to a vet a year back and it had something similar on it's hand, it started out as black and then turned red and large a week after.

Doc said it was a tumor and removed it. Didn't mention anything about cancer, and it was a whopping 250 bucks for the surgery.

My chicken is about 5 months old and this thing just showed up on its eyelid. It was black and looked like it could have been dirt or something. When I pulled on it, the whole black scab came off and it was really red and bloody. I thought of taking a picture but I started disinfecting everything and put it in the coop, it's dusk out so I thought it could dry up and I would do something in the morning.

I have a few questions I hope I can get some help with:

Is this anything other than a tumor?

Does chicken blood from a tumor present a risk to humans?

Does tumor blood present a risk to the other chickens?

Any help would be appreciated!
 
I'm assuming you have other chickens, and if so one of them pecked her in the eye is all and broke the skin. Just a scab, keep it clean and she'll be fine!
